Welcome to Delhi, the vibrant capital city of India! Begin your honeymoon by checking into your pre-booked hotel and freshening up. In the morning, venture out to explore the iconic Red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its stunning architecture and historical significance. In the afternoon, take a romantic stroll through the beautiful Mughal Gardens, located within the Rashtrapati Bhavan complex. As the evening sets in, head to Hauz Khas Village, a trendy neighborhood known for its eclectic mix of art galleries, boutiques, and restaurants.
Start your day with a visit to Jama Masjid, one of the largest mosques in India. Marvel at its grandeur and climb the minaret for panoramic views of the city. Afterward, dive into the bustling streets of Chandni Chowk, Delhi's oldest and busiest market, where you can indulge in local street food and shop for traditional clothing and jewelry. In the afternoon, explore the serene and beautiful Humayun's Tomb, a breathtaking Mughal mausoleum. In the evening, take a romantic boat ride on the serene waters of the Yamuna River.
Immerse yourself in Delhi's rich cultural heritage today. Start by visiting the magnificent Akshardham Temple, a spiritual haven known for its stunning architecture and tranquil surroundings. Spend the afternoon exploring the National Museum, which houses an impressive collection of Indian art and artifacts. In the evening, enjoy a memorable classical dance performance at the prestigious Kamani Auditorium.
Embark on a romantic day trip to Agra, home to the magnificent Taj Mahal. Marvel at the beauty of this UNESCO World Heritage site, considered one of the Seven Wonders of the World. Explore the intricate marble work, stroll through the lush gardens, and capture unforgettable moments. Afterward, visit the Agra Fort, a grand Mughal fortress that offers breathtaking views of the Taj Mahal. Return to Delhi in the evening.
Today, immerse yourselves in the spiritual side of Delhi. Begin with a visit to the serene Lotus Temple, a Bahá'í House of Worship known for its remarkable lotus-shaped architecture. Spend the afternoon exploring the peaceful surroundings of the Lodi Gardens, where you can enjoy a romantic picnic amidst nature. In the evening, witness the divine Aarti ceremony at the famous Akshardham Temple.
On your last day in Delhi, indulge in a delicious breakfast at one of the city's famous breakfast spots, such as Sita Ram Diwan Chand or Saravana Bhavan. Afterward, spend some time shopping for souvenirs at the vibrant markets of Delhi, such as Janpath and Dilli Haat. In the afternoon, visit the beautiful Qutub Minar,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its towering minaret. Say goodbye to Delhi and cherish the memories of your romantic honeymoon.
For an off the beaten path experience, consider visiting the serene Lodhi Art District, where you can admire stunning street art and murals created by local and international artists. If you're looking for a romantic dinner with a view, head to Olive Bar & Kitchen in Mehrauli, which offers a beautiful outdoor setting and delicious Mediterranean cuisine. Another local favorite is the Lodhi Gardens Restaurant, where you can enjoy a romantic meal amidst the lush greenery of the gardens.
